Over the years, The Muppets History account has created a massive social following. Fans love the fun facts and pieces of Muppet history that the account shares. Muppets History is considered one of the best accounts for Muppets fans to follow on both X and Instagram, where it has a combined total of nearly 800,000.

But on Monday, December 2, the typically lighthearted page took a more serious tone, addressing “concerns” that had come about. The post continued to apologize for boundaries being crossed, but specifics were not mentioned.

When the post first went up, fans were confused about what exactly the page was talking about. However, before long, it was revealed that Joshua had been sending private messages to various women, many of whom felt he crossed boundaries and was sexually harassing them. What made things even worse is that Holly is Josh’s wife.

The attacks continued as the message was criticized for being intentionally vague and not apologizing for anything specific. This led Joshua to post a second message. In that message, he admitted to crossing boundaries for years.

He ended the tweet by announcing that the page would be closing down, most likely permanently.

What made this particularly upsetting to many was the fact that the diehard Muppet fandom is relatively small, meaning that many people know someone affected by Joshua’s sexual harassment.

But the page was much more than just a fandom for everyday folks. There are a number of celebrities who also show their love for the Muppets by following the page.

Muppets Mayhem cast gathers around
Credit: Disney

The years of harassment came to a head when Megan Maloney, a fellow Muppets fan, received sexually charged comments from Joshua on Instagram via the Muppets History account.Megan told The Verge that she tried to laugh them off at first, but as they became more overtly sexual, she shared them with a small group of friends.

Megan says that the “floodgates” opened after she shared her screenshots, learning many more women to come forward.
